Subject: Quickstore 4.2 — bloom filter now fronts the KV layer

Plugin authors: starting with this release, Quickstore places a bloom filter ahead of the key-value store. Negative lookups return faster; false positives fall through safely. No API changes are required on your side. Verify your plugin against the staging build referenced below.

session token of fahif-tadup = htk3_9c7

Quarterly Planning Note — Insurance Renewal

For the incoming director: the Bramwick facility policy with Haverston Mutual renews next quarter. Premiums up eleven percent; broker cites regional flood revisions. Options: accept, raise deductibles, or tender to Orlane Underwriting. Recommendation: tender, keep Haverston as fallback. Claims history clean except the Pellworth incident, now closed. Decision needed within thirty days. Renewal strategy connects to the confidential plans noted below.

internal memo for yahag-tahog: The pricing group signed off on a budget of $152.8 million for Project Soriel.

TICKET-977: Flaky DNS in the Quillmere sandbox — resolver sometimes falls back to the public upstream because the internal nameserver entry got dropped from the env during last week's cleanup. If you're the new contractor picking this up: don't chase the app code, it's fine. Re-add the resolver host, bump the TTL to 60, restart the sidecar. The internal DNS service also needs its auth entry, which sits on the very next line.

secret setting of yajog-taguf: ARCHIVE_KEY3=051

Title: Scheduler double-waters bed 3 after DST shift

New folks: the Verdella scheduler stores watering slots in local time. After the clock change, slot 06:00 fires twice, soaking the herb bed. Fix: store UTC, convert at display. Repro on the Oakhollow test rig only. To reproduce, install the firmware identified by the token below.

build token for hafop-kahog: htk31_a432ac515d5bb1362002c1e1a7e80ef

### Step 4: Pin the resolver before deploying

Heads up — the Copperline cluster has a flaky upstream DNS resolver that occasionally returns stale records for the artifact registry, so deploys sometimes pull nothing and quietly retry. We now pin the resolver in the deploy container and verify the registry endpoint before fetching. Once resolution checks pass, the pipeline verifies each artifact against our deploy key, which is listed below for your review.

release key, fahaf-bajof: bky3_Xam